About Zhanxiang Zhou
Zhanxiang Zhou is a scholar working on Nutrition and Dietetics, Pathology and Forensic Medicine and Biochemistry, having authored 105 papers that have together received 6.0k indexed citations. Recurring topics across this work include Alcohol Consumption and Health Effects (33 papers), Trace Elements in Health (30 papers) and Liver Disease Diagnosis and Treatment (29 papers). The work is most often cited by research in Pathology and Forensic Medicine (1.7k citations), Nutrition and Dietetics (1.2k citations) and Biochemistry (425 citations). Zhanxiang Zhou has collaborated with scholars based in United States, China and Japan. Frequent co-authors include Craig J. McClain, Zhenyuan Song, Y. James Kang, Yin Kang, Y. James Kang, Xiuhua Sun, Wei Zhong, Xinguo Sun, Wei Zhong and Lipeng Wang. Their work appears in journals such as Journal of Biological Chemistry, The Journal of Experimental Medicine and Journal of the American College of Cardiology.
